How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bonita South?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bonita South Studio Apartments | $2,022 | $1,871 | $2,295 |
Bonita South 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,553 | $2,187 | $3,300 |
Bonita South 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,104 | $2,056 | $4,307 |
Bonita South 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,939 | $3,320 | $4,568 |

Cheapest Available Bonita South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Bonita South area of San Diego, CA is a Studio unit found at Eucalyptus Grove Apartments priced from $2,015. Point Bonita has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$2,187. Here are the most affordable Bonita South apartments for rent in San Diego, CA: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Eucalyptus Grove Apartments | STUDIO A | Studio,1BA | $2,015 |
Point Bonita | Design 1F | 1BR,1BA | $2,187 |
Park Bonita | 1 Bed 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$2,439 |
Teresina | Sapphire | 1BR,1BA | $2,456 |
Bonita Hills | 1 bed 1 bath | 1BR,1BA | $2,495 |
